WebAn extremely large brown bear may have a skull 18 inches long and 12 inches wide. Such a bear, when standing on its hind feet, is about 9 feet tall. Brown bears possess an amazing sense of smell. They are likely able to detect scents from miles away, especially downwind. WebJul 25, 2024 · Not surprisingly, the results indicate bears eat a lot of salmon. Adult male bears on Kodiak ate the most salmon on average, consuming an incredible 6,146 pounds (2,788 kg) per bear per year! Adult females ate 3,007 pounds (1,364 kg).
